Iceland moss (Cetraria Islandia L.) belongs to the Lichenophyta family. It is a conection (symbiosis) between fungus and algae. Herbal raw material of the plant is Lichenes Islandii thallus, which contains mucus compounds (lichenin, isolichenin), silicium acid, lichen acids, mineral salts. Products made from iceland moss can be used for irritation of oral cavity and throat, dry cough and loss of apetite. They can also be used in the cosmetic industry as a moisturising and softening ingredient.
